The Tripru comes with dedicated storage for just about any travel carry-on you can imagine. It has a large storage space for your clothes, accessible with a 180° opening flap and fully equipped interior straps to prevent your clothes from getting crushed. It also has its own removable IPX8 waterproof laundry bag, so your old and dirty clothes can be kept in a separate bag away from clean clothes.

40L Capacity and 180 Degree Shell Opening – The top zipper opens directly at 180 degrees, creating a large opening where you can easily access all your gear.

The Tripru also comes with its own sanitary bag made of sweet plastic, which makes it waterproof so you won’t even think about spilling your shampoos and conditioners on your clothes and tech.

Speaking of technology, Tripper also features a laptop sleeve that fits your laptop, tablet, and phone, keeping your gadgets secure with a Feedlock locking system. Wondering where to keep your chargers? There are mesh bags for everything, you can even put a power bank inside and connect it to your phone using the USB port built into the bag design… and that’s just the storage solutions in the Tripper bag. .

On the outside, the Tripru comes with its own ventilated shoe bag in a backpack lined with a special anti-bacterial fabric. The backpack is equipped with quick-access RFID blocking pockets for things like your wallet and passport, and although the Tripper is constructed with hydrophobic water-repellent fabric and waterproof YKK zippers, each bag has its own rain cover. The elements are not the only thing that travelers and tourists worry about and Triparm is well aware of that. While an RFID blocking bag gives you a certain level of security, the carrier comes with its own anti-theft system in the form of a branded shoulder strap, which is then wrapped around something secure and locked in place to prevent anyone from tampering with it. Pick up and drop off with your bag.

The Tripper Bag is also equipped with Okoban, a global lost and found database that allows other people to notify you if they find your lost bag… although I recommend putting an Airtag in the bag for good measure.

The bag is equipped with a chest strap that takes the pressure off your shoulders or alternatively, you can attach both shoulder straps together and turn it into a single strap, allowing you to carry your tripper like a duffel bag.

Additionally, each tripper includes a small shoulder sling bag to store small items like your phone, glasses, wallet, AirPods, etc. The sling bag can be used independently even on most days when you are out of the house.
